
♻️ August 8 is “Reuse Day” in Japan!
Officially recognized by the Japan Anniversary Association, this day was created by the Japan Reuse Business Association — a network of companies and organizations dedicated to reuse.
The number 8 resembles a loop, symbolizing circulation — a perfect fit for reuse. That’s why 8/8 was chosen!
🌀 Why does it matter?
To raise awareness, encourage reuse practices, and help build a transparent, sustainable circular society.
